How to Download and Fix emp.dll Errors: Troubleshooting and Official Download Guides

Are you encountering frustrating DLL errors related to emp.dll and wondering how to resolve them safely? Whether you're a PC user, gamer, or professional, DLL errors can disrupt your workflow or gaming experience. This comprehensive guide will walk you through understanding emp.dll, how to download it securely from official sources, troubleshoot common errors, and take preventative measures to keep your system stable and secure.


Understanding emp.dll and Its Role in Windows

What is emp.dll?

emp.dll is a Dynamic Link Library (DLL) file—a crucial component in Windows and various software applications. DLL files contain code, data, and resources that multiple programs can share, promoting efficient use of system resources. Specifically, emp.dll may be associated with certain gaming modules, enterprise applications, or specialized software that leverages this library for core functionalities. In simple terms, emp.dll functions as a helper library that provides specific features required by an application to run properly. Its presence enables programs to access necessary routines without duplicating code.

Common Reasons for emp.dll Errors

Emp.dll errors usually occur due to:

  • Missing emp.dll file: The file was accidentally deleted or misplaced.
  • Corrupted emp.dll: The file has become corrupted because of malware, failed updates, or disk errors.
  • Incorrect versions: Using incompatible or outdated versions of the DLL.
  • Software conflicts: Conflicts with other software or outdated drivers interfering with DLL functions.
  • System issues: Windows system corruption or failed updates can affect DLL files. Understanding these causes helps in choosing the right troubleshooting approach.

pasted-1763707077940

Typical Error Messages

Users often encounter specific messages indicating emp.dll issues, such as:

  • "The program can't start because emp.dll is missing."
  • "Failed to load emp.dll."
  • "Entry Point Not Found" (indicating that a specific function in emp.dll cannot be located).
  • "The specified module could not be found." These errors can appear during application launch, system startup, or after installing new software.

Impact of emp.dll Errors

Such DLL errors can cause:

  • Application crashes or failures to launch.
  • System instability and freezes.
  • Errors propagating to other programs that depend on emp.dll.
  • Overall slowdown in system performance. Prompt troubleshooting is essential to restore normal operations and prevent further issues.

How to Download emp.dll Safely from Official Sources

Step-by-step Guide to Download emp.dll

To fix emp.dll errors, you may need to download the DLL file. However, it's critical to do so safely from trusted sources to avoid malware risks: 1. Identify the Correct Source:

  • The best way to get emp.dll is via official runtime packages or installers associated with the software that needs it.
  • Check the official website of the program or vendor that utilizes emp.dll, as they sometimes provide downloadable DLL packages.
  • Microsoft’s official Windows Update or Visual C++ Redistributables may include required DLLs.
  • Download from Reputable Libraries (if applicable):

  • Use well-known, reputable DLL repositories such as Microsoft support pages, official software sites, or reinstall the source application.

  • Avoid unknown third-party sites promising free DLL downloads—they may contain malware or corrupted files.
  • Using Official Runtime Downloads:

  • For Windows system files, ensure your Windows OS is up-to-date via Windows Update.

  • For software-specific DLLs, reinstall the specific program, which will place the correct DLL version.

Avoiding Unsafe Sites and Potential Malware Risks

  • Never download emp.dll from suspicious websites or file-sharing platforms.
  • Always verify the source before downloading.
  • Scan downloaded files with reliable antivirus software.
  • Avoid using generic DLL download sites—they often contain outdated or malicious files.

Manual Repair and Troubleshooting Steps

If you’ve already downloaded emp.dll or have a copy, here are detailed steps to manually replace or register the DLL:

Manual Replacement of emp.dll

  1. Backup Existing System Files:

  2. Create a restore point or backup your system to avoid data loss.

  3. Locate the Current emp.dll:

  4. Typically found in C:\Windows\System32 (for 32-bit) or C:\Windows\SysWOW64 (for 64-bit), depending on your system architecture.

  5. Replace the DLL:

  6. Copy the new emp.dll into the appropriate folder.

  7. Overwrite the existing file if prompted.

Registering DLL Files with RegSvr32

  1. Open Command Prompt as an administrator.
  2. Enter the command:
regsvr32 C:\Path\To\emp.dll
  1. Press Enter and wait for the confirmation message.

Running System File Checker (SFC) and DISM

These tools repair corrupted system files and restore missing DLLs:

  • System File Checker (SFC):
  • Open Command Prompt as administrator.
  • Enter:
    bash sfc /scannow
  • Wait for the process to complete and follow any prompts.

  • Deployment Image Servicing and Management (DISM):

  • In Command Prompt, run:
    bash DISM /Online /Cleanup-Image /RestoreHealth
  • Restart your computer after completion.

Preventative Measures and Best Practices

Keeping Drivers and Software Updated

  • Regularly update Windows and all installed applications.
  • Install driver updates for hardware components, especially graphics, sound, and network devices.

Routine System Maintenance and Scans

  • Use antivirus software to scan for malware that could corrupt DLL files.
  • Keep your system free from unnecessary files and clutter.
  • Create system restore points before major updates or installations to revert if issues arise.

Using Reliable Backup Solutions

  • Backup important files regularly.
  • Maintain system image backups to restore your entire system if necessary.

Conclusion

Dealing with emp.dll errors can be frustrating, but with the right approach, these issues are manageable. Always prioritize downloading DLL files from official or reputable sources to keep your system secure. Employ built-in Windows tools like SFC and DISM for effective troubleshooting, and follow best practices such as keeping software updated and running routine scans. Remember, proactive maintenance and cautious downloads not only fix current issues but also prevent future DLL-related errors, safeguarding your system stability and security. If problems persist, consider consulting professional support or reinstalling affected applications. Stay vigilant, update regularly, and keep your system running smoothly!